BJ11 AAZ is a 2011 Suzuki Gsxr 750 L0 in White with a 749c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.

Across all 2011 Suzuki Gsxr 750 L0 models, the average MOT pass rate is 85.3% with a typical mileage of 12,282 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Suzuki Gsxr 750 L0 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 18 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J11 AAZ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Suzuki Gsxr 750 L0 typically stays on UK roads for around 16 years. At 15 years old, this Suzuki Gsxr 750 L0 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
